**Alert: Lintwarden baseline drift detected.** The static-analysis baseline file for the Peltgrove monorepo has diverged from what the Lintwarden scanner expects, meaning roughly forty suppressed findings are no longer matched and may resurface as new violations in CI. This is not blocking merges yet, but it will once the grace window closes on Friday. Owners of affected modules should regenerate the baseline locally and verify the diff before committing. Full remediation steps are documented on the internal page here:

operations page: https://jenkins.zemvarcloud.local/job/merge_requests/repo/build/73930b4b30f0a8ed

Subject: Handover — partner SFTP drop ingest

Hi Tomas,

Handing over the Greylock partner SFTP ingest. Plugin authors drop CSVs nightly; the loader picks them up at 02:00 and writes rows to the staging schema. Failed files land in the quarantine table with a reason code. To inspect staging or quarantine, connect to the ingest database with the string below.

warehouse DSN: mssql://rusdor_svc:0FSWCn9@db-951a.paliqforge.local:5432/ulawyn

## Onboarding: Quotaforge per-tenant rate limits

Quotaforge enforces per-tenant rate quotas at the ingress tier for Harwell Cloud. Each tenant's quota document is versioned, reviewed, and signed before the enforcer will load it — unsigned documents are dropped and alerted on. As a security reviewer, you should verify every quota change against the enforcer's trusted signer, shown below.

rollout seal: bky4_x7Gc

## Experiment Assignment: Splitgate

Splitgate is our A/B assignment service. Clients call it once per session with a subject key; it returns bucket assignments for all active experiments. Assignments are deterministic — same key, same bucket — so never cache them yourself. Config changes go through the Marrowfield review queue; contractors can propose but not approve. Do not hardcode experiment names in client code; use the generated constants. Staging uses a separate hash salt. Full API reference and bucket math are on the page below.

operations page: https://confluence.tolvaqsys.corp/spaces/pages/pages/6e787158f507